Episcopalianism

name

Etymology

From Episcopalian + -ism.

  1. derived from ἐπίσκοπος — “watchman, overseer
  2. derived from episcopus
  3. derived from episcopālis
  4. inherited from episcopal
  5. suffixed as episcopalian — “episcopal + ian
  6. suffixed as episcopalianism — “Episcopalian + ism

Definitions

  1. The doctrines and practices of Episcopalians.
